How far is Worland, WY, from Tuxtla Gutiérrez?

The distance between Tuxtla Gutiérrez (Tuxtla Gutiérrez International Airport) and Worland (Worland Municipal Airport) is 2080 miles / 3348 kilometers / 1808 nautical miles.

The driving distance from Tuxtla Gutiérrez (TGZ) to Worland (WRL) is 2522 miles / 4058 kilometers, and travel time by car is about 48 hours 5 minutes.

Distance from Tuxtla Gutiérrez to Worland

There are several ways to calculate the distance from Tuxtla Gutiérrez to Worland. Here are two standard methods:

Vincenty's formula (applied above)
  • 2080.398 miles
  • 3348.076 kilometers
  • 1807.816 nautical miles

Vincenty's form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points on the earth's surface using an ellipsoidal model of the planet.

Haversine formula
  • 2084.742 miles
  • 3355.067 kilometers
  • 1811.591 nautical miles

The haversine form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points assuming a spherical earth (great-circle distance – the shortest distance between two points).
